Add to your Cargo.toml:
[dependencies]
mloggerai = "0.0.2"
toml
[dependencies]
mloggerai = { path = "../mloggerai-rust" }
Create .env file in the project root:
OPENAI_API_URL=https://api.openai.com/v1
OPENAI_API_KEY=sk-xxxxxxx
OPENAI_API_MODEL=gpt-4
OPENAI_API_PROMPT=Trova il bug e proponi la soluzione in modo conciso.
use mloggerai::errorsolver::{ErrorSolver, ErrorSolverConfig};
fn main() {
let solver = ErrorSolver::new(ErrorSolverConfig {
log_file: Some("logs/logger.log".to_string()),
output_language: Some("italiano".to_string()),
..Default::default()
});
solver.log("INFO", "Applicazione avviata");
solver.log("ERROR", "Errore generico di test");
}
use mloggerai::errorsolver::{ErrorSolver, ErrorSolverConfig};
fn main() {
let solver = ErrorSolver::new(ErrorSolverConfig {
output_language: Some("italiano".to_string()),
..Default::default()
});
match solver.solve_from_log("Errore: panic in thread principale") {
Ok(solution) => println!("✅ Soluzione AI: {}", solution),
Err(e) => eprintln!("❌ Errore AI: {}", e),
}
}
use mloggerai::errorsolver::{ErrorSolver, ErrorSolverConfig};
fn main() {
let solver = ErrorSolver::new(ErrorSolverConfig {
base_url: Some("http://127.0.0.1:11434/v1".to_string()),
model: Some("llama3".to_string()),
output_language: Some("inglese".to_string()),
log_file: Some("logs/custom.log".to_string()),
..Default::default()
});
solver.log("INFO", "Test con modello personalizzato");
match solver.solve_from_log("NullPointerException at MyClass.java:42") {
Ok(solution) => println!("💡 AI Suggestion: {}", solution),
Err(e) => eprintln!("❌ Errore: {}", e),
}
}
